ОПИСАНИЕ
Одновременно с записью в память кода DTC ECM сохраняет параметры состояния автомобиля и условий движения как данные фиксированного набора параметров. При поиске неисправностей данные фиксированного набора параметров позволяют определить, двигался автомобиль в момент возникновения неисправности или нет, был ли прогрет двигатель, какой была топливовоздушная смесь (обедненной или обогащенной) и т.д.

ОЖИДАЮЩИЕ ОБРАБОТКИ ДАННЫЕ ФИКСИРОВАННОГО НАБОРА ПАРАМЕТРОВ
Tech Tips
Ожидающие обработки данные фиксированного набора параметров запоминаются, если код DTC с логикой диагностирования за 2 поездки впервые регистрируется во время первой поездки.
Подключите GTS к DLC3.
Установите замок зажигания в положение ON (ВКЛ).
Включите GTS.
Войдите в следующие меню: Powertrain / Engine / Trouble Codes.
Выберите код DTC, чтобы вывести на экран соответствующие ему данные фиксированного набора параметров, ожидающие обработки.
Tech Tips
Ожидающие обработки данные фиксированного набора параметров удаляются при выполнении одного из следующих условий.
Коды DTC удалены с помощью GTS.
Провод отсоединен от отрицательного (-) вывода аккумуляторной батареи.
После восстановления нормальных условий был проведено 40 ездок с полностью разогретым двигателем. (Ожидающие обработки данные фиксированного набора параметров не будут удалены только за счет восстановления нормальных условий.)
Если при уже хранящихся в памяти и ожидающих обработки данных фиксированного набора параметров код DTC с логикой диагностирования за 2 поездки впервые регистрируется во время первой поездки, хранящиеся в памяти старые данные заменяются новыми данными фиксированного набора параметров, ожидающими обработки.
